Introduction

Lumateperone, an atypical antipsychotic drug approved in 2021 for bipolar depression, has a dual mechanism of action by combination of activity at central serotonin (5-HT2A) and dopamine (D2) receptors. In India, Quetiapine is one of the approved drugs for use in depressive episodes for bipolar disorder.

Objectives

This post-hoc analysis of an Indian Phase 3 study was conducted to evaluate the correlation of quality of life assessed via Quality-of-life enjoyment and satisfaction-short form questionnaire (Q-LES-Q-SF) and severity of hypomania symptoms via Young Mania Rating Scale (YMRS) when treated with Lumateperone 42mg or Quetiapine 300mg.

Methods

The phase-III, randomized, multi-centric, assessor-blind, parallel-group, active-controlled, comparative, non-inferiority study included patients with Bipolar II depression with moderate severity having a Montgomery-Asberg depression rating scale (MADRS) score ≥20 and Clinical global impression–bipolar version–severity (CGI-BP-S) score ≥4. The study was conducted after receiving regulatory and ethics committee approvals. The patients were randomized (1:1) to either receive Lumateperone 42mg [Test] or Quetiapine 300mg [Comparator] for 6 weeks. In this post-hoc analysis, correlation between Q-LES-Q-SF and YMRS were evaluated and for safety outcomes treatment emergent adverse events (TEAEs) were assessed. [Clinical trial registration: CTRI/2023/10/058583]

Results

This post-hoc analysis included 462 patients [231 each in Test and Comparator]. The baseline demographic characteristics were comparable in between treatment arms. The Pearson’s correlation coefficient between Q-LES-Q-SF score and YMRS score was statistically significant for both treatment arms at Day 42 [Test: -0.268, p<0.0001; Comparator: -0.281, p<0.0001] and the linear regression between 2 arms was not statistically significant (p=0.8603), indicating weak negative correlation between the 2 scales [Figure 1 and Figure 2]. The incidence of TEAEs were similar in both treatment arms [Test: 34.6%; Comparator: 35.5%] and no serious adverse events were reported.

Image 1:

Image 2:

Conclusions

This post-hoc analysis demonstrated that patients with Bipolar II depression when treated with Lumateperone 42mg or Quetiapine 300mg, the improvement in Q-LES-Q-SF score is inversely proportional to YMRS score and both treatments were well tolerated.
